Factors Affecting Cost
Kitchen painting projects in Scott County, MN, vary based on several factors including the scope of work and materials used. Understanding typical project considerations can help homeowners plan effectively and compare options for their kitchen updates.
- Materials: Standard latex or oil-based paints suitable for kitchen environments, with options for primers and specialty finishes if needed.
- Size and Scope: Ranges from painting a single accent wall to comprehensive repainting of cabinets, walls, and ceilings in medium-sized kitchens.
- Labor Complexity: Varies depending on surface preparation, cabinet painting, and whether color changes require additional work like stripping or sanding.
- Permitting: Generally not required for interior painting projects unless structural modifications are involved, but local regulations should be verified.
- Extras: Optional finishes such as glazes, protective coatings, or decorative techniques can add to project scope and cost.
